International Media Reports on the Start of Negotiations Regarding the Nagorno-Karabakh Issue

International media outlets have reported the commencement of negotiations regarding the resolution of the situation in the Nagorno-Karabakh conflict zone, set to take place in Geneva on October 8 and in Moscow on October 12. These reports cite French Foreign Minister Jean-Yves Le Drian.

The spokesperson for the Armenian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Anna Naghdalyan, informed Armenpress that there is currently no scheduled bilateral meeting between the foreign ministers of Armenia and Azerbaijan.

“We (the co-chairs of the OSCE Minsk Group—representatives from France, Russia, and the USA) are in daily contact with each other. No progress has been made on this issue yet. Meetings will take place tomorrow in Geneva, followed by further meetings in Moscow,” Jean-Yves Le Drian stated during his appearance before members of the French National Assembly's International Affairs Committee.

The French minister expressed hope that it would be possible to restore negotiations between the parties.
